> calculate dir size: there's a good content plugin for that, I think 
> it's called dirsize. "content" is one of 4 types of plugins for TC: 
> content (columns), file system, lister (viewers), packer (compress). 
> With dirsize you can do manual/auto fore/background calculate. 
> Recommended. Thread on ghisler forum.
